My Buying Guides on Glass Pitchers With Lid

Why I Prefer Glass Pitchers With Lid

When I shop for drinkware, I usually lean toward glass pitchers with lid because they feel practical and elegant at the same time. I like being able to see what’s inside, whether it’s water, iced tea, juice, or infused drinks. In my experience, the lid also helps keep drinks fresher for longer and reduces spills when I move the pitcher from the fridge to the table.

What I Look for in the Glass Quality

The first thing I check is the quality of the glass. I prefer thick, durable glass that feels sturdy in my hand. Thin glass may look nice, but I’ve found it can be more fragile and less reliable for everyday use. If I plan to use the pitcher often, I look for borosilicate glass because it tends to handle temperature changes better than regular glass.

Why the Lid Matters to Me

The lid is just as important as the pitcher itself. I usually look for a lid that fits securely so it doesn’t slip off while pouring or storing. Some lids are stainless steel, some are plastic, and some are silicone-sealed. In my experience, a tight-fitting lid makes a big difference if I want to keep dust out or store beverages in the refrigerator without odors mixing in.

Size and Capacity I Consider

I always think about how many people I’m serving. For daily use, I find a medium-sized pitcher works well for my household. If I’m hosting guests, I prefer a larger capacity so I don’t have to refill it often. On the other hand, if I mainly use it for myself, a smaller pitcher is easier to handle and store.

Ease of Pouring and Handling

For me, a comfortable handle and a well-designed spout are essential. I don’t want liquid dripping down the side every time I pour. I also pay attention to the pitcher’s weight when it’s full, because a heavy pitcher can be awkward to lift. A good grip and smooth pouring experience make the pitcher much more enjoyable to use.

Cleaning and Maintenance

I always check whether the pitcher is easy to clean. A wide mouth is helpful because I can reach inside more easily with a sponge. If the pitcher is dishwasher-safe, that’s even better for my routine. I also look at whether the lid has multiple parts, since more parts can sometimes mean more effort during cleaning.

Style and Design I Like

Since the pitcher often sits on my table or in my fridge, I care about how it looks too. I usually choose a design that feels simple, modern, and versatile. Clear glass works best for me because it matches almost anything, but I also appreciate subtle patterns or textured finishes when I want something a little more decorative.

Safety and Durability Features

I always make sure the pitcher is made with safe, food-grade materials. If I use it for hot and cold drinks, I want it to be built for that purpose. I also look for strong construction around the handle, base, and rim, since those are the areas that tend to get the most wear over time.
